Castaways Season 1 Episode 5: Shocking Survival Twist!

In Castaways Season 1 Episode 5, the group confronts the growing tension between survival instincts and fading hope as resources dwindle. This episode sharpens the emotional stakes while revealing new layers of each castaway’s personality under extreme pressure.

Viewers witness a pivotal shift in group dynamics, where early alliances begin to unravel and individual motives come into sharper focus. The narrative uses the isolation of the island to explore themes of trust, leadership, and moral compromise.

Leadership Struggles and Decision Making

Episode 5 places leadership under a microscope as characters debate rationing, shelter security, and risk-taking. The debate exposes contrasting philosophies on command, forcing the group to choose between strong control and collaborative input.

Impact of Authority on Group Morale

Tension rises when one castaway questions the fairness of recent decisions. This confrontation reveals underlying grievances and highlights how perceived fairness affects cooperation on the island.

Resource Scarcity and Survival Tactics

Limited freshwater and food supplies drive strategic choices that test both creativity and restraint. Castaways experiment with new foraging methods and adjust daily routines to extend available resources.

Short Term Adjustments vs Long Term Planning

The group splits between immediate calorie intake and building long term sustainability. Some advocate aggressive exploration, while others prioritize securing the existing camp.

Psychological Strain and Isolation

As days pass without clear rescue, psychological fatigue becomes visible in altered sleep patterns and withdrawn behavior. Episode 5 captures subtle shifts in body language and conversation tone that signal growing despair.

Moments of Connection and Conflict

Brief moments of humor and shared laughter provide temporary relief but also underscore how isolation magnifies small interactions. Conflict erupts when stress triggers old insecurities and unresolved tensions.

Signals, Exploration, and Rescue Prospects

With the possibility of rescue in sight, the team argues over how aggressively to signal for help. Some favor staying hidden to avoid unwanted attention, while others see visibility as the only path to timely extraction.

Evaluating Risk in Signaling Efforts

The episode weighs the pros and cons of smoke signals, mirror flashes, and vocal calls. Each option carries tradeoffs between energy expenditure, detection range, and potential danger from unknown parties.

How does Episode 5 change the power balance among castaways?

Episode 5 redistributes influence by challenging the established leader and elevating a previously cautious castaway into a more vocal rival. The shift redefines informal roles and sets up future confrontations over strategy.

What survival tactics are introduced in this episode?

The group experiments with rationing schedules, rotating guard duty, and improved water collection methods. These small innovations highlight how incremental changes can significantly extend limited resources.

How does the episode portray psychological strain on the castaways?

Subtle signs such as increased irritability, interrupted sleep, and reduced motivation reveal mounting psychological pressure. Moments of vulnerability contrast with bursts of defiance, illustrating the complex emotional landscape of isolation.

What role does uncertainty about rescue play in decision making?

Uncertainty fuels division, with some advocating aggressive signaling and others favoring caution. This debate shapes nearly every major choice in the episode, from camp security to foraging routes.
